Where do I look for the Canadian Real Estate market statistics?

Two good places to look are the Canada Mortgage and Housing Corporation (CMHC) – they issue all kinds of reports on housing activity in Canada: http://www.cmhc-schl.gc.ca/en/index.cfm, and the Canadian Real Estate Association (CREA), essentially the national real estate agent`s association: http://www.crea.ca/. The CMHC will give you a better overview on things like new houses built, mortgages, etc., where the CREA will provide statistics on housing prices, sales by region, etc. Keep in mind the CREA statistics do not take into account sales done without the brokerage of a real estate agent , i.e., `for sale by owner` – which can skew the numbers by a significant percentage.
